P&G China selects Nurun for interactive briefs

SHANGHAI - Procter & Gamble has selected Nurun China as its agency of record for Olay, Vidal Sassoon, Pantene, Safeguard, Braun and Gillette, tasking the agency to develop "integrated, campaignable" creative strategies for the brands' online presence.

Nurun, which is believed to have edged out several unnamed agencies during the review, had previously worked on the brands on a project basis.

Yann Lombard-Platet, managing director of Nurun China, also confirmed the agency would now move to open a Guangzhou office to service the P&G account, and tipped an increase in staff numbers to handle the business.
